Description Devlands is a gamified Git learning platform that transforms complex Git repositories into interactive 3D worlds. It offers an intuitive visual approach to understanding Git concepts like branching, merging, and commit history, making learning engaging for developers of all skill levels. Language Reactor is an AI-powered browser extension and web application that transforms passive content consumption into an active language learning experience. It integrates seamlessly with streaming platforms, e-books, and websites, providing learners with dual subtitles, instant dictionary lookups, and AI-driven explanations. This tool is ideal for anyone looking to improve their proficiency in a new language by immersing themselves in authentic content and receiving contextual support.
What It Does It converts Git repositories into immersive 3D visualizations, allowing users to explore commit history, branches, and merges in a gamified environment for easier understanding. The tool overlays interactive language learning features directly onto video content (like Netflix, YouTube) and text-based content (web pages, e-books). It displays subtitles in both the native and target language simultaneously, allowing users to click on unfamiliar words or phrases for instant definitions and AI-generated grammar explanations. Users can also save vocabulary for later review.
